1.Describe a thing that you purchased recently. You should say:


• What it was
• What it looks like
• How you bought it
• And explain how you felt about it.

Sample answer

[1] I'm going to describe my mobile phone which I bought on a special occasion. It is a useful brand-new
black Iphone that is made of metal and tempered glass. (WHAT, describe briefly)

[2-3] Several years ago, when I passed the university entrance exam with flying colors (thi điểm cao),
my parents smiled from ear to ear (vui sướng hạnh phúc) and they decided to reward me with
something. Since I am a big fan of Apple, I asked them whether I could have my own cell phone.
They said yes and took me to a mobile shop on Thai Ha street – a go-to place for tech geeks (người mê
công nghệ) . I was over the moon (vui sướng, hào hứng) because that was a bargain (giá hời) . I mean
you can never buy a new one for just 13 millions at that time. When it comes to other stores, it’s not
the case (compare) You might pay through the nose (trả hố) for low-quality goods if you do not have
the technical know-how (kiến thức kỹ thuật)

5. Describe a good law in your country.


You should say:
• What is the law
• How you came to know about this law
• Whom does it affect
• Why is it good

Useful language
• Set of laws and orders / Public safety
• Legalize/Law-abiding
• Commit a crime/ Custodial sentence/Imprisonment
Sample answer
● Smoking is undoubtedly a bad habit with numerous detrimental impacts on smokers
and on society as a whole. Not a single benefit of smoking could be found until today
and so the government of Australia has become rigid on the issue of smoking here and
there. I welcome a law that bans smoking in public places and which ensures that
cigarettes are sold in plain packets.
● Besides, the government has also initiated plain packaging for tobacco products. It
points out that all the tobacco products should be sold in a generic packet. There should
be no advertisements for tobacco products on the packets. And all the brands will have
the same colour in their pack. Any sort of imagery or branding is banned after the recent
law that came into force in 2012. However, the brand name of the cigarette brand
should be placed in a preset font and on a specific part of the packet. The health
warning should be mentioned clearly. The plain packaging system is also introduced in
some other states but Australia is the leading one in the case.
● When the stringent anti-smoking law came into force, it was publicised on mainstream
media. I came to know about the issue from the mass media reports and other
publications. Moreover, there were some silent moves by the tobacco companies and
they tried to stop the process of plain packaging. But they were a failure. Despite the
barriers from the tobacco companies, the government implemented the law and made
it a must for them to sell cigarettes in plain packets. Disobeying the law is subject to
severe punishment in terms of monetary fine and sentence for imprisonment.
● People across the country and islands are highly satisfied with the anti-smoking law
provisions. In fact, it was troublesome to tolerate cigarette smoke in public transports
and places like bus stoppages, medical centres, theatres, schools, colleges, shopping
malls and other public places. This was a big problem for the non-smokers to comply
with the cigarette smoke. As a result, the number of health disorders was on the rise.
But with the initiation of the new anti-tobacco law, non-smokers are relieved to a great
extent. The rate of smoking in public places has reduced to a great extent. Besides,
there is a decline in cigarette sales as well. So, it appears that people have accepted the
law gladly and abided by it as much as they can.
● This is really a good law for the state. Smoking is detrimental both for the smokers and
the non-smokers. Besides, smoking cigarettes is also harmful to the environment. The
attempt from the government to stop the use of tobacco is really appreciated. It is
anticipated that someday the use of tobacco will come down to a great extent and that
is the expectation from everyone.
